WebJan 26, 2024 · Real one dollar bills will have a green treasury seal to the right of the portrait under the text, "ONE". The treasury seal should be clear and sharp. [6] 3. Check for the Federal Reserve Bank seal. This seal is black and to the left of the portrait. The letter inside of it corresponds to a Federal Reserve Bank. インスタ dm色変わる

WebCounterfeit money is currency produced without the legal sanction of a state or government, usually in a deliberate attempt to imitate that currency and so as to deceive its recipient.
